Collaborating with a web development company can be an exciting and transformative experience for your business. However, knowing what to expect during this process is crucial to ensure a smooth and successful partnership.
Here's a comprehensive guide on what you can anticipate when working with a web development company.
1. Initial Consultation and Discovery
The process typically begins with an initial consultation. During this phase, you’ll discuss your project’s goals, target audience, and specific requirements with the development team.
This is a crucial step where the company gathers essential information to understand your vision and objectives. Be prepared to answer questions about your brand, competitors, desired features, and budget.
2. Proposal and Agreement
After the initial consultation, the web development company will provide a detailed proposal outlining the project scope, timeline, costs, and deliverables.
This proposal acts as a roadmap for the entire project. Review it carefully and ensure all your requirements are included. Once you’re satisfied, both parties will sign an agreement or contract to formalize the partnership.
3. Planning and Strategy
The next step involves detailed planning and strategy development. The company will create a project plan that includes timelines, milestones, and responsibilities.
They may also conduct market research and competitor analysis to refine the project’s direction. This phase ensures everyone is aligned and sets clear expectations for the development process.
4. Design Phase
In the design phase, the focus is on creating the visual aspects of your website. The design team will develop wireframes and mockups to give you a preliminary look at the website’s layout and design.
You’ll have the opportunity to provide feedback and request revisions. This iterative process continues until the design meets your approval. Key elements such as color schemes, typography, and branding will be finalized during this stage.
5. Development Phase
Once the design is approved, the project moves into the development phase. The development team will start coding and building the website’s functionalities.
Front-end and back-end development are carried out simultaneously to ensure a seamless user experience. Regular updates and progress reports are typically provided to keep you informed about the development process.
6. Content Integration
During development, content integration also takes place. This involves adding text, images, videos, and other multimedia elements to the website.
You may need to provide content or collaborate with the company’s content creators. Ensuring high-quality, relevant content is essential for engaging users and improving SEO.
7. Testing and Quality Assurance
Before the website goes live, thorough testing is conducted to identify and fix any issues. The web development company will perform various tests, including functionality testing, usability testing, performance testing, and security testing.
This phase ensures the website is free from bugs and performs optimally across different devices and browsers.
8. Review and Launch
After testing, you’ll review the final website to ensure it meets your expectations. Any last-minute changes or adjustments will be made at this stage. Once you give the final approval, the website will be launched.
The company will deploy the website to a live server, making it accessible to your audience.
9. Post-Launch Support and Maintenance
A reliable web development company provides post-launch support to address any issues that may arise after the website goes live.
This includes fixing bugs, making minor updates, and providing technical support. Additionally, they may offer ongoing maintenance services to ensure your website remains secure, up-to-date, and performs well over time.
10. Communication and Collaboration